Cellulose:-
It is the main constituent of plant cell walls and the most common and abundant of the D-glucose polymers. This does not occur in the animal body. It is a homopolymer =of glucose like starch, except the linkages joining the glucose units are P(1+4) rather than a(1+4). Hence, cellulose is made up of P-glucose molecules linked by P(1,4) glycosidic linkage.
